Can you just follow a car?
in principle, you may only follow a car if the car is your property. So placing a car tracking system in your own car to see where your child is going when you lend the car is legally permitted. The placing of a car tracking system under another's car may not, with a few exceptions. For example, the investigation agency may follow a car with a technical tool to support their investigation.

How to follow a car?
You can follow a car with a GPS tracker which is a small box that contains a GPS receiver with an internal memory or SIM card. This box to follow a car is sold in all kinds of different versions and with different functions. The most common device for following a car is a box with a GPS receiver and a SIM card module. If you want to follow the car, send an SMS message to the GPS system and you will receive an SMS back with the position of the car. Because these systems to follow a car can be bought for less than 200 euros, this is easy to do yourself.

It is also possible to hire a detective agency to follow a car. Such a desk then observes the car and often follows the car to follow it. Whenever possible, a criminal investigation agency also uses a GPS system to track a car, and because such a bureau may in legal cases use a GPS system to track a car, many people and companies use a criminal investigation agency.  

Select system to follow a car:
If you are considering purchasing a system to track a car, it is advisable to first check the following questions to find out which car tracking system best suits your needs.

Do you have access to the car you want to follow?
When you have access to the car you want to follow, you can opt for a tracking system that is not watertight and can be connected to the car's battery if necessary. When the system needs to be hidden in the car you want to follow, the best place in the car is under the dashboard, because the tracking system is the least blocked by metal. If you do not have access to the car you want to follow, it is necessary to purchase a tracking system that is watertight and has a magnet attachment so that you can, for example, place it on the support beam in the rear bumper of the car.

At what interval does the car want to follow?
If you want to follow the car live so that you can see it driving over your screen, it is important to choose a system with a long battery life or a system that can be connected to the battery of your car. Such systems to track a car use more power to enable the high position interval. However, if you only want to know the location of the car you want to follow a few times a day, a system is sufficient that works on the basis of SMS messages and the battery capacity can also be a little less, because this car tracking system uses less power .

How to view the positions of the car?
If you want to see the positions of the car you want to follow on your mobile phone such as an iPhone, you need a tracking system which sends the positions in a link by SMS so that you can view them directly in your internet browser or a system which sends the positions of the car to be tracked to a website, which must then be suitable for mobile phones. Such a car tracking system is often referred to as an internet or GPRS tracking system. If you do not need to see the positions of the car directly, it is better to go for a GPS system to follow a car that stores the locations on the internal memory and does not transmit it at all. So you need the tracking system again to view the locations and connect it to your computer like a USB stick and then see exactly where the car has been, where the car has stopped and for how long. These systems to track a car are also called GPS data loggers.
